System settings for the PC-80

Here’s how to assign a specified parameter to the VALUE encoder.

* The assignment of the VALUE encoder is valid only in

Play mode

(p. 60) and in

Controller mode

(p. 67).

fig.util*

1

Simultaneously press the

MIDI CH

button and

PGM CHANGE

button,

and hold them down for a few moments.

The PC-80’s display will indicate “UTL,” and you will be in Utility mode.

fig.sy0

2

Press the

[SYSTEM]

key on the keyboard.

“SY0” appears (blinking) in the display.

3

Use the

VALUE

encoder or the

[5]

key of the keyboard to choose “

SY5

.”

fig.enter

4

Press the

ENTER

button.

* If you press any other button without pressing the ENTER button, the setting will be

cancelled.

5

Use the

VALUE

encoder or the keyboard to specify the parameter.

VALUE ENCODER

Specified parameter

This setting lets you transmit a specified parameter by turning the PC-80’s VALUE encoder.

To transmit the parameter value

When you operate the VALUE encoder in What is Controller mode? (p. 67), the
corresponding value for the parameter you specified will be transmitted.

“Using the VALUE encoder to transmit values for a specified parameter”

(p. 78)
